After upgrading an auctioned ES4 with a replacement dashboard, the scooter works and connects to the app but it will not switch modes when you double-tap the button.
Doing so just toggles the light, and whenever you turn on the light it activates the speed limit!
It does not however alter the LCD display which always shows the red-S indicating sport mode whether the speed is limited or not.
FYI the default functionality is a single-tap activates the light and a double-tap changes modes from Limit-mode (no S), regular-mode (blue S) and sport-mode (red S)
So now if anyone wants to use the scooter they cannot activate the light or it will cut the max speed in half.
Any idea how to fix this? Firmware has already been updated to latest.
